Administrative Assistant Jobs

An Administrative Assistant works to support office functions and ensure that daily operations run smoothly. Their responsibilities may include answering and directing phone calls, managing calendars and appointments, preparing reports, maintaining filing systems, and providing general support to visitors. They often act as the point of contact for clients, suppliers, and team members, so excellent communication skills are crucial. Proficiency in MS Office, especially Excel and Word, along with strong organizational and time management skills are also important. The ability to multitask and prioritize tasks is a must. Certifications that can boost their prowess in the role include the Certified Administrative Professional (CAP) or the Microsoft Office Specialist (MOS) certification.

Prior to becoming an Administrative Assistant, a person might have roles that provide relevant experience and skills. For instance, they could start as a Receptionist, where they would gain experience in managing communications and providing customer service. Another possible role is a Data Entry Clerk, which would help develop proficiency in using office software and maintaining records. Alternatively, they may be an Office Assistant, assisting in various office tasks and learning how the different parts of an office work together.

Highest Education Level

Administrative Assistants off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
31.9%
High School or GED
25.5%
Associate's Degree
17.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
13.3%
Master's Degree
8.0%
Some College
2.2%
Doctorate Degree
0.9%
Some High School
0.8%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Administrative Assistants
1-2 years
44.2%
Less than 1 year
30.3%
None
13.6%
2-4 years
10.1%
4-6 years
1.9%
